When a young witch inherits a rather cantankerous family heirloom; she has to figure out how to outwit her cursed companion.
The Table had been in the Witch's family for a very long time.
No one remembered who had cursed it to stay with them forever, but none of them liked it much.
The young witch initially tries to thwart the Table's shenanigans. But after some time living with the Table, she begins to notice how cold the kitchen floor is on a brisk winter's day, how many nicks and scratches the Table has endured, and how hard it is to stand on all four legs for so many hours, and she comes to realize compassion will get her further than cleverness. This charming and hilarious picture book is about empathy and trying to find common ground with the people—or furniture—around you.
